Also a tip. Give yourself plenty of time if you still plan on visiting after this review. The speaker at the order menu is a decoration. The orders are taken at the window. If you order something not readily available, choose a platter or have an order considered sizable you'll have to wait in the parking lot and then go through a second drive through window.
